About this service

Landscape boulders are large, natural stones used as focal points or to provide structural support for sloped terrain. You would incorporate them into your yard if you want to add a rugged, permanent aesthetic or need to stabilize a bank. The price typically depends on the size of the stone, the difficulty of moving it into place, and the logistics of delivery.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

How long does landscape fabric typically last?

Landscape fabric, when installed correctly, can last anywhere from 5 to 10 years, depending on the quality of the material and environmental factors. It helps suppress weeds and retain soil moisture. Over time, it may degrade or become less effective, but it significantly reduces maintenance needs during its lifespan. The crew can advise on the best type of fabric for your specific project.

What is involved in landscaping stone installation?

Landscaping stone installation begins with site preparation, which may include excavation and grading. The stones are then carefully placed, often on a prepared base of sand or gravel for stability. For pathways, the stones are laid to create a smooth walking surface, and for borders, they are set to define garden beds. The pros ensure proper alignment and secure placement for a lasting result.
